Cold Springs Processing Salary

As of July 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Cold Springs Processing in the United States is $88,223.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$42. Salaries at Cold Springs Processing typically range from $77,688 to $99,600 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

About Cold Springs Processing
Cold Springs Processing began in 1983. Our permit was first obtained from the Texas Department of Health in 1980, and we have gone through three major amendments with the Texas Water Commission and Texas Commission on Environmental Quality. What Is the Cost of Living Near Fort Worth?

Understanding the cost of living near Fort Worth is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Cold Springs Processing.
Fort Worth's Cost of Living Index is approximately 97.3 (2.7% less expensive than US average; 4.6% more than TX average). 'Cowtown', Dallas's sister city, more affordable housing. Trinity Metro.
